Modification of the existing maximum residue level for flonicamid in various crops.

Abstract

In accordance with Article 6 of Regulation (EC) No 396/2005, the applicant Dienstleistungszentrum Ländlicher Raum submitted a request to the competent national authority in Germany to modify the existing maximum residue level (MRL) for the active substance flonicamid in radishes. Furthermore, in accordance with Article 6 of Regulation (EC) No 396/2005, the applicant ISK Biosciences Europe N.V. submitted a request to the competent national authority in the Netherlands to modify the existing MRLs for the active substance flonicamid in strawberries, cane fruits, other small fruits and berries, lettuces and other salad plants, and pulses (dry beans, lentils, peas, lupins). The data submitted in support of the request were found to be sufficient to derive MRL proposals for strawberries, blackberries, raspberries, other small fruits and berries, radishes, lettuces and other salad plants, and pulses (dry beans, lentils, peas and lupins). Adequate analytical methods for enforcement are available to control the residues of flonicamid on in the commodities under consideration. Based on the risk assessment results, EFSA concluded that the short-term and long-term intake of residues resulting from the use of flonicamid according to the reported agricultural practices is unlikely to present a risk to consumer health.

摘要

根据欧盟委员会第396/2005号法规第6条,申请人“农村地区服务中心”向德国国家主管当局提交了一份申请,请求修改萝卜中活性物质氟啶虫酰胺的现有最大残留限量(MRL)。此外,根据欧盟委员会第396/2005号法规第6条,申请人“ISK生物科学欧洲有限公司”向荷兰国家主管当局提交了一份申请,请求修改草莓、藤本水果、其他小型水果和浆果、生菜及其他沙拉植物以及豆类(干豆、小扁豆、豌豆、羽扇豆)中活性物质氟啶虫酰胺的现有最大残留限量。经审查,提交的支持该申请的数据足以得出草莓、黑莓、树莓、其他小型水果和浆果、萝卜、生菜及其他沙拉植物以及豆类(干豆、小扁豆、豌豆和羽扇豆)的最大残留限量建议。有足够的执法分析方法来控制所涉商品中氟啶虫酰胺的残留量。基于风险评估结果,欧洲食品安全局得出结论,按照报告的农业操作方法使用氟啶虫酰胺产生的残留量短期和长期摄入均不太可能对消费者健康构成风险。
